Understanding Web Hosting Security: Top Measures You Should Implement
2023 was a bad year for cybersecurity, with a record number of attacks taking place, and 2024 is already shaping up to be similarly beleaguered by hacking attempts, with almost 10,000 incidents being reported within the first five months.
This should certainly turn up the heat on web hosting solutions that want to remain robust and retain customers. It’s just a case of picking cutting edge security measures, rather than settling for incumbent approaches.
Here are a few examples to get you started.
Protecting Data Integrity with Homomorphic Encryption
Homomorphic encryption is a relatively nascent technology, but promises a groundbreaking way to protect data integrity. Unlike traditional encryption methods that require decryption for processing data, homomorphic encryption allows computation on encrypted data without exposing it. This can revolutionize how sensitive information is handled in web hosting environments.
Understanding the Basics
Homomorphic encryption works by performing operations on ciphertexts (encrypted texts) that translate directly into meaningful results once decrypted.
So in the case of financial institutions that need to process customer transactions securely, and where a typical breach will cost $5.9 million to recover from, there are two main benefits:
- Secure Computation: Banks perform complex calculations without ever decrypting user data.
- Privacy Preservation: User information remains private even during processing.
The real magic lies in maintaining privacy while enabling computations necessary for analytics and decision-making processes.
Practical Implementation in Web Hosting
Incorporating homomorphic encryption within web hosting setups involves several technical steps:
- Algorithm Selection: Choose from various types of homomorphic encryptions like Fully Homomorphic Encryption (FHE), Partially Homomorphic Encryption (PHE), or Somewhat Homomorphic Encryption (SHE).
- Key Management Systems (KMS): Use robust KMS to manage cryptographic keys essential for encrypting and decrypting data.
- Performance Optimization: Ensure servers are optimized based on your understanding of x86 vs x64 architectures, since these differences can significantly impact performance when handling intensive computations under encrypted conditions.
Following these steps means sites can all but guarantee secure and efficient management of client data without compromising speed or reliability.
Ensuring Robust DDoS Mitigation Strategies
Distributed Denial of Service (DDoS) attacks have become increasingly sophisticated and frequent, with a 196% spike reported last year. Web hosting services must implement robust strategies to safeguard their infrastructures from these threats. An effective DDoS mitigation plan ensures uptime, maintains performance, and protects the integrity of hosted websites.
Understanding DDoS Attacks
DDoS attacks overwhelm a server or network with massive traffic volumes, causing legitimate requests to be denied. And whether you want to create a photography website or run the online presence of a multinational, they are a serious threat.
The main types include:
- Volumetric Attacks: These flood bandwidth using amplified traffic.
- Protocol Attacks: These exploit weaknesses in Layer 3/4 protocols like SYN floods.
- Application Layer Attacks: These target specific applications or services to disrupt functionality.
Understanding these types is crucial for devising appropriate defenses, or simply for choosing a suitable secure hosting package if you’re a site owner.
Key Mitigation Techniques
Mitigating DDoS attacks involves a multi-layered approach incorporating several advanced techniques:
1. Traffic Analysis & Filtering
- Use AI-driven analytics tools to differentiate between legitimate and malicious traffic.
- Implement rate limiting to control the volume of incoming requests during an attack.
2. Scrubbing Centers
- Route incoming data through scrubbing centers that clean traffic by removing malicious packets before they reach your servers.
3. Content Delivery Networks (CDNs)
- Leverage CDNs which distribute content across multiple locations globally, making it harder for attackers to target a single point effectively.
4. Anycast Network Routing
- Distribute inbound traffic across multiple servers using anycast routing technology; this prevents any one server from becoming overwhelmed during an attack.
5. Automated Incident Response Plans
- Develop automated scripts that trigger when anomalies are detected, instantly activating mitigation protocols without human intervention delays.
Utilizing Secure Access Service Edge (SASE) in Web Hosting
Secure Access Service Edge, or SASE, represents a paradigm shift in how web hosting security is managed. This architecture combines network security functions with wide-area networking (WAN) capabilities to create a unified, cloud-native service.
And with 94% of businesses embracing the cloud in some form, there’s familiarity with this approach which helps legitimize it further. Integrating these elements means SASE delivers enhanced performance and robust protection tailored for modern web environments.
Core Components of SASE
Understanding the core components of SASE is crucial to grasping its impact:
1. Software-Defined WAN (SD-WAN)
- Optimizes traffic routing based on real-time conditions.
- Enhances connectivity across dispersed locations without compromising speed or reliability.
2. Security Service Edge (SSE)
- Incorporates critical security measures like secure web gateways (SWG), cloud access security brokers (CASB), and zero trust network access (ZTNA).
3. Cloud-Native Architecture
- Leverages the scalability and flexibility of cloud infrastructure.
- Facilitates seamless integration with existing cloud services and platforms.
These components work together to form a cohesive framework that addresses both networking efficiency and comprehensive security.
Implementing SASE in Web Hosting
Adopting SASE within web hosting involves several strategic steps:
1. Assessment & Planning
- Evaluate current infrastructure to identify areas where traditional models fall short.
- Plan the transition by mapping out necessary integrations with SD-WAN, SSE components, etc.
2. Deployment Strategy
- Gradual Deployment: Start with critical applications/services before expanding system-wide.
- Comprehensive Rollout: Simultaneously implement this across all systems for uniformity.
3. Monitoring & Management Tools
- Utilize centralized dashboards providing visibility into network performance/security status.
- Employ AI-driven analytics for predicting potential threats and optimizing response times.
Final Thoughts
If you already have other security measures in place, picking up the latest in encryption, DDoS protection and SASE solutions will give you that peace of mind you need to run a rugged, reliable web hosting setup. The alternative is leaving yourself at the mercy of malicious actors, which is simply unacceptable.